Best Value: KMC Z51/Z8 bicycle chain
Top PickThis chain fits 6, 7, and 8-speed bikes. The links are 1/2 x 3/32 inches, and there are 116 links in a package.

Best Ease of Use: Zonkie 116-link bike chain
This chain is designed to be as easy as possible. The links are simple to install and disassemble as well as clean and reuse. They are very durable and designed to resist both rust and corrosion so you can use them for a long time.

Best for BMX: KMC Z410 Bicycle Chain
The Z410 comes in a variety of colors for you to choose from. This is a good chain for BMX, Fixies, Cruisers, track bikes, and more. The chain has 112 links and works great for single-speed needs.

Best Single Speed: Schwinn bicycle chain
This 1/2 x 1/8 inch chain comes with 112 links. It's fully nickel-plated and designed for heavy-duty, which even makes it resistant to being dropped. It works for single-speed bikes.

Best for All Speeds: Sram PC 11-speed bicycle chain
This 114-link chain is strong, precise, and built to last. It can work with all 11-speed groupsets, and the PowerLock chain connector ensures an easy and consistent way to connect chains.

Best Repair Kit: Oumers bike link plier + chain breaker + missing links repair tool kit
The missing links can work with 6, 7, 8, 9, and 10-speed chains. The chain pliers make for quick removal of joining links, so you can remove and reconnect faster. Use the rivet extractor to remove and install pins.
